On Marriage and Concupiscence

De Nuptiis et Concupiscentia

Augustine of Hippo · 354 – 430

Marriage is good, its three goods are offspring, fidelity, and the bond — and yet the desire by which children are conceived is itself disordered, and carries the fault forward into every child born. Julian of Eclanum read this and accused Augustine of never having stopped being a Manichaean.
